Valley Hunger Unprecedented

Hunger in the Central Valley has been described as an epidemic. The recession, furloughs and the westside water crisis is taxing the Community Food Bank into being a 12 month operation. 30 Million tons of food are being served a year now in Fresno County, that's the size of San Francisco's food bank. In this Central Valley Focus, Jon Brent goes one on one with Community Food Bank president Dana Wilkie. The single most important thing we can do to help is to volunteer and donate just 1 dollar.
